Common Appliance Repair Scams in Zapata
Be aware of these tactic used by unlicensed operators
Upfront Payment Demand
Scammer quotes a repair, demands 50% or full payment upfront for 'parts,' then vanishes or does shoddy work.
Fake Parts Replacement
Inspects briefly, claims expensive part failure requiring full replacement, installs cheap or used part, overcharges.
Bait-and-Switch Pricing
Lowballs phone quote to get in the door, then claims 'additional issues' doubling or tripling the price onsite.
Unlicensed Fly-by-Night Operator
Poses as local tech, no business cards or truck logos, disappears after payment with no warranty.
How to Verify a Professional
Insurance
Ask for a Certificate of Insurance (COI) listing general liability coverage (at least $500K recommended) and workers' compensation if they have employees. Contact the insurance company directly using the info on the COI to ensure it's active. Don't accept just a verbal promise.
Licensing
Texas doesn't require a specific license for all appliance repairs, but work involving refrigeration, electrical, or plumbing needs TDLR licensing. Verify any claims at tdlr.texas.gov by searching the technician's name or license number. Call TDLR at (800) 803-9202 for confirmation.
References
Request at least 3 recent references from Zapata County customers. Call them to ask about the work quality, timeliness, and if they'd hire again. Cross-check online reviews on Google, BBB.org, and Yelp for patterns.
